It's probably just a glitch or coding error that will be fixed. They don't actually get your fingerprint or face ID when people use those, you simply authenticate through Android/Apple and phone software/hardware (actual fingerprint reader). It should be an easy fix, The first time you use it, it should require the verification code and TOS acceptance, It will also do this if you powerwash your phone or get a new phone for security reasons (you must reauthenticate). The security protocols should be handed off after that and it should work seamlessly. Nearly every banking app and a bunch of other apps already use this and have been for a while, since way back with Samsung Pay (original MST was the best) and Google Pay. It's nothing new and this shouldn't be happening, It will get fixed. 2 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
